Firstly, I have Armageddon 1.2 installed, I've also installed the most recent DAIM, but no other mods.
I noticed in my most recent Soviet game that I can liberate puppets which I'm not supposed to be able to liberate (I've liberated RSI, Flanders and Wallonia, I can also liberate Vichy France). After doing a bit of digging around, it seems that the countries that you can liberate is controlled by revolt.txt, variable intrinsic_gov_type. However, these variables seem to be set correctly (intrinsic_gov_type = fascist for RSI, etc.).
Did some testing with France, if I set intrinsic_gov_type = fascist for Algeria, France can still liberate them, same for leninist. However, Communist Vietnam works correctly, it's not in the list of countries to liberate for France, if I comment out the intrinsic_gov_type tag for them, they appear in the list. I know an easy solution to this is just not to liberate the countries you're not supposed to, but I'd still like the system to work properly. Any ideas would be much appreciated
